TU vs. Elms College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, TU or Elms College?

  • College of Our Lady of the Elms is 435.2% more expensive to attend than TU for in-state tuition ($38,735.00 vs. $7,238.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 66.7% higher at Elms College than Towson University ($38,735.00 vs. $23,240.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Towson University than Elms College ($14,443 vs. $23,498)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Towson University are 8.7% lower than costs at College of Our Lady of the Elms ($13,642 vs. $14,830)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at College of Our Lady of the Elms than Towson University (98% vs. 74%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by College of Our Lady of the Elms students is 137.5% larger than aid received Towson University ($27,109 vs. $11,415)

TU vs. Elms College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, TU or Elms College?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between Elms College or TU .

  • The average SAT score at Towson University (1081) is 105 points higher than at Elms College (976)
  • Incoming TU students have a 1 point higher average ACT score (23) than students at Elms College (22)
  • Accepted freshman TU students have a 0.27 point higher average high school GPA (3.69) than students at Elms College (3.42)
  • Elms College has a higher acceptance rate (90.9%) than TU (78.6%)

TU vs. Elms College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, TU or Elms College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Elms College and TU.

  • The graduation rate at TU is higher than College of Our Lady of the Elms (64% vs. 58%)
  • Graduates from Towson University earn on average $7,200 more per year than Elms College graduates after ten years. ($53,500 vs. $46,300)
  • Towson University students graduate with a $7,250 lower median federal student loan debt than Elms College graduates. ($17,750 vs. $25,000)
  • TU graduates are paying $75 less per month on federal student loans than Elms College graduates. ($183 vs. $258)
  • More TU gra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Elms College students, three years after graduation. (69% vs. 61%)
